King’s students fight to revoke Peres’ honourary doctorate
A King’s College lecturer was amongst political activists urging students to push for an academic boycott of Israel on Friday, at a conference on campus condemning the college’s decision to award an honorary doctorate to President Shimon Peres. »
King’s occupation now in progress
King’s students have occupied a lecture theatre in the Strand campus, calling for the university to revoke the honorary doctorate awarded to Shimon Peres last term. »
